Understanding Zap Execution Order in Zapier: Optimize Your Workflows
Published on Feb 28th, 2024
As the digital world continues to evolve, automating online tasks has become essential for enhancing productivity and efficiency. Zapier stands out as a powerful tool that helps users create automated actions, known as Zaps, to connect apps and services seamlessly. One of the most common inquiries among users is understanding the order in which Zaps run.
Each Zap in Zapier is an individual entity that operates independently from others. When you set up multiple Zaps, it's critical to recognize that Zapier doesn't have a default execution order for Zaps because they are event-driven. This means that Zaps execute when their trigger event occurs, regardless of the order in which they were created.
How are Zaps Triggered?
Zaps are based on triggers and actions. A trigger is an event in an app that starts your Zap. Once the trigger occurs, Zapier fetches the relevant data and performs the designated action in another app. For instance, if you have a Zap that adds new Google Contacts entries to a Mailchimp list, the Zap will run each time you add a new contact.
What About Concurrent Zaps?
When several Zaps have the same trigger, they run in parallel. The process is asynchronous, allowing multiple Zaps to operate simultaneously once triggered, without waiting for each other to complete. This independent processing ensures that your Zaps are efficient and responsive.
Maximizing Efficiency & Avoiding Conflicts
To maximize workflow efficiency and prevent potential conflicts:
- Stagger trigger events: Where possible, design your workflow to stagger the trigger events for your Zaps, reducing the likelihood of triggering multiple Zaps at the exact same moment.
- Prioritize your Zaps: Assess the importance and impact of each Zap. Prioritize setting up Zaps that are critical for your workflow before others that might have less immediate impact.
- Monitor your Task History: Keep an eye on your Zapier Task History to track the performance of your Zaps and troubleshoot any issues that arise from overlapping Zaps.
Concluding Thoughts
Understanding the nuances of how Zaps run is crucial for effectively automating your tasks with Zapier. Remember, Zaps function independently, and their execution is entirely driven by the occurrence of trigger events. By meticulously planning your automation strategy with these points in mind, you can streamline your workflows and ensure that your Zaps run smoothly in tandem.